NAME

       wtype - xdotool type for Wayland

SYNOPSIS

       wtype [TEXT]

       wtype [OPTION_OR_TEXT]... -- [TEXT]...

       wtype [OPTION_OR_TEXT] -

DESCRIPTION

       wtype  is  a Wayland tool that allows you to simulate keyboard input like xdotool type for
       X11.  This is accomplished via the virtual-keyboard Wayland protocol.

OPTIONS

       Modifier can be one of "shift", "capslock", "ctrl", "logo", "win", "alt", "altgr".  Beware
       that the modifiers get released automatically once the program terminates.

       Named keys are resolved by libxkbcommon, valid identifiers include "Left" and "Home".

       -M MOD Press modifier MOD.

       -m MOD Release modifier MOD.

       -P KEY Press key KEY.

       -p KEY Release key KEY.

       -k KEY Type (press and release) key KEY.

       -d TIME
              Sleep  for  TIME  milliseconds  between  keystrokes when typing texts.  Can be used
              multiple times, default 0.

       -s TIME
              Sleep for TIME milliseconds before interpreting the following options. This can  be
              used to perform more complicated modifier sequences.

       -      Read text to type from stdin. This option can appear only once.
